Disney Infinity was an action-adventure sandbox video game series developed by Avalanche Software and published by Disney Interactive Studios. The games consist of characters and themes from Disney-owned brands, including iconic Disney, Pixar, Marvel, and Star Wars, in a customizable universe known as the Toy Box. Although the games and characters can still be purchased today, the franchise was cancelled in 2016 due to low sales.
Games[]
- Disney Infinity
- Main article: Disney Infinity
The first game, Disney Infinity, was released on August 18, 2013. The IOS version was discontinued later and is not playable on IOS 11 or later.
- Disney Infinity: 2.0 Edition
- Main article: Disney Infinity: 2.0 Edition
The second game, Disney Infinity: 2.0 Edition (or Disney Infinity: Marvel Super Heroes), was released on September 23, 2014. The game introduced Marvel characters and equipment as well as an expanded cast of Disney characters or "Disney Originals". The IOS version was later discontinued.
- Disney Infinity: 3.0 Edition
- Main article: Disney Infinity: 3.0 Edition
The third game, Disney Infinity: 3.0 Edition, was released August 30, 2015. This game includes elements of Star Wars, much like the last game, as well as playable characters from Avengers: Age of Ultron and Inside Out, among other Disney characters. The IOS version was discontinued at some point after 2016.
This edition was different from the other installments of the franchise, as instead of releasing a series of figures based mainly on Disney's current film slate before moving on to another game entirely, it focused on releasing as much content as possible for its current edition, and then moving onto another edition sometime much later than usual.
